This podcast episode explores a research study on automated body
condition scoring in dairy cows using artificial intelligence and
standard 2D side-view images. The analysis demonstrates how
deep-learning models can accurately estimate body condition while
reducing the subjectivity and labor associated with traditional
visual scoring methods. A key question is whether digital
assessment tools can provide more consistent and scalable
monitoring of nutritional status across commercial dairy herds.
Particularly noteworthy is the use of explainable AI, which
confirmed that the system relies on biologically meaningful
anatomical features such as ribs and hip structures when
generating its predictions. The study highlights how affordable
image-based technologies could strengthen precision herd
management by improving nutrition decisions, health monitoring,
and overall production efficiency. Withcomments on a "Journal of
Dairy Science"-article (6/2026) by Lei Lao and others:
